KBC Conducts Trainers’ Seminar
March 28, 2005

Malihkrang Uma/ Myitkyina

The Kachin Baptist Church, KBC, convened a two-week seminar in Myitkyina, northern Burma, on March 24th for trainers from Kachin Christian community to develop their training capacity.

The seminar was sponsored by the Rangoon-based American Center, which sent American teacher to the seminar. The KBC’s Leadership Training Committee is administering the seminar, which runs from March 24 to April 9.

Rev Sabaw Sinwa Naw, chairman of the KBC’s Leadership Training Committee, said that “this program aims to raise good leaders.” He added that conducting the training in Burma is convenient as it is more financially feasible than sending students abroad.

The sixteen seminar participants come from the KBC, the Nawng Nan and Kuthkai branches of Kachin Theology College, the University Christian Fellowship, the Young Men’s Christian Association, and other churches in Myitkyina.

The KBC’s Leadership Training Committee hopes to provide skills for the students to prepare them for future study abroad. The KBC’s Leadership Training Committee is a subcommittee of KBC.
